My dad and I had a wonderful day out on Lake Erie and were starving as we pulled our jetski out of the water. Mexican food sounded perfect so I did a general search of the Sandusky area for not only a nearby Mexican restaurant but one that could accommodate a trailer in their parking lot. Thankfully Nacho's Mexican restaurant checked all the boxes. The parking lot allowed us to pull through with the trailer attached without blocking traffic or taking up too much room. We were greeted quickly when we walked in, taken to a booth, and provided chips and salsa almost as soon as we sat down. The waiter came by shortly after and took our drink order and made sure he was available if we had any menu questions. I ended up ordering the pollo loco (and a ground beef soft taco on the side) and my dad got the burrito Cozumel (he wanted a burrito like he would get at Chipotle.....) The food came out crazy quick and super fresh and hot. I had to let my tortillas and soft taco cool a few moments before I was able to dig in as everything was indeed as hot as we had been warned by the staff. Flavor wise, the cheese sauce on my dish was great. The chicken was topped with the cheese sauce and a healthy serving of onions with sides of refried beans and rice (and three small soft tortillas) I ended up making three mini tacos with items from my dish. The tortillas seemed house made and they were quite good. The soft taco was excellent, the ground beef was very well seasoned and was a perfect a la carte side. My dad really enjoyed his "chipotle" burrito. Said the steak inside was very seasoned and flavorful. He was quite happy with it overall. Glad we found this restaurant on our trip out to Sandusky this afternoon and would visit again next time we find our way out in Sandusky Bay.

We came as a family to this Mexican restaurant for a quick lunch before heading to Cedar Point. Very good location (right on the road to the park) and we had very high hopes. Husband very much enjoyed his fajitas, and kids meal selection was excellent and kids loved it. However, my lunch was a disaster. I ordered the quesadilla supreme, with chicken, and when it arrived it was a few chunks of steak inside a tortilla that had been fried separately, with a very small amount of cheese. When I asked for chicken instead of steak, they just scraped everything off of the one tortilla and put chicken and very little cheese in the same tortilla. (This should be the first indication that something was very very wrong because you should not be able to reuse the tortilla on a quesadilla.) I was frustrated that there was Very little cheese, and the cheese that was there was shredded cheese I had not even been melted. So I asked for more cheese, and reluctantly sent it back third time. When it came back it was still the same tortilla, but this time they have poured queso all over it, and it was so soggy you would not even be able to pick it up to eat it. overall this is one of the most disappointing Mexican meals I've ever eaten.
